KEY FEATURES
Inlet Surge Protection – Built-in protection for the UPS and all connected equipment against power surges.
Automatic Voltage Regulation – Incoming power is monitored to avoid harmful over- or under-voltage conditions. Power is increased in Boost
mode and decreased in Buck mode.
Battery Backup for WattBox IP Devices– Battery backup for powering critical equipment connected to a WattBox IP device during power
outages and uctuations. Batteries can be serviced without turning the UPS off.
Emergency Power Off – Built-in contact for EPO.
PC Connection – Built-in connections for PC access to the GUI and shutdown control to notify the PC when battery level is critical.
SNMP Card (sold separately) – Use the SNMP card to access the GUI over Ethernet and notify devices on the network when the battery level is
critical.
IMPORTANT – BATTERIES ARE DISCONNECTED FOR SHIPPING
When you receive your UPS, the internal backup batteries are disconnected from the circuit board for safety during shipping. Re-connect the wires
before installing the UPS.
Step 1 Step 2 Step 3
Remove front panel. Connect the battery wires. Replace the front panel.

watt box WB-OVRC-UPS-2000-1 Specifications

General IconGeneral
ModelWB-OVRC-UPS-2000-1
TopologyLine Interactive
Surge ProtectionYes
Transfer Time4-6ms
Operating Temperature32°F to 104°F (0°C to 40°C)
Nominal Input Voltage120V
Input Voltage Range90V - 140V
Output Voltage120V
Output Frequency60Hz
AVRYes
USB Communication PortYes
Battery TypeSealed Lead Acid (SLA)
Humidity0% to 95% non-condensing
CertificationsFCC
Warranty3 years
Form FactorTower
